Battle Royale is a japanese film set in the near future.  After the millenium it seems that Japan ran into some trouble.  Teen crime is on the rise, as are the unemployment numbers.  This prompts the government to start what is called the "BR Act" (Battle Royale Act).  Basically this means that the government will randomly take a group of students to a deserted island, strap bombs around their necks and make them fight for their lives!  ROCK ON!

Having heard a lot about this film, and having wanted to see it for quite some time; I was highly entertained!  Although the plot is a little "out-there" this film comes off as believeable as any other film.  The characters are all around the ages of 14-15, and guess what!?  The actors are actually that age!  No more thirtysomethings trying to be a teenager in a film!  YES!

The main point that sold me on this movie was the interaction of the characters.  Eventhough they are all set to kill each other, they still make jokes about who has a crush on who.  One particular scene comes to mind.  A girl gets ambushed by an ex boyfriend of hers.  He proceeds to threaten to rape her.  This all ends with the boy being stabbed in his nether regions about five times.  

Oh yeah, did I mention that this film is brutal?  I mean BRUTAL!  Each teen is given a bag with food and a weapon.  The weapon is random.  They range from binoculars to automatic weapons.  Thankfully, the violence is not too extreme in this film, it's just the nature of the killings that make them so brutal.  Petty differences from the childrens school play a major part in who they hunt down in the film.  If you weren't in someone's group, then watch out for them, as they will probably still hold a grudge against you.

By far one of the best action films I have seen in quite some time.  The violence is brutal, the story line is interesting, and the characters are likeable.  I am quickly starting to fall in love with Japanese cinema.  This film, and Versus have become two of my favorite films in the span of only a week.  Now if only I can get a copy of The Happiness Of The Kakaturis or a copy of Suicide Club.
